Commissioning Lead
Dublin (on-site role)
A long-term data centre programme in Dublin requires an experienced Commissioning Lead to join the delivery team on a large-scale build. The project involves coordinating specialist vendors responsible for bringing key mechanical and electrical systems through testing, verification, and handover stages.
This position is embedded on site and involves close interaction with engineering, QA, safety, and construction delivery teams to ensure systems reach the required commissioning milestones.
What the Role Involves
* Looking after day-to-day commissioning tasks on site across both mechanical and electrical packages.
* Keeping track of progress against the commissioning schedule and identifying any areas that need attention.
* Working directly with vendor teams to ensure the work being carried out matches the scope and documentation.
* Making sure testing records, scripts, and sign-offs are completed properly and filed.
* Attending and sometimes leading commissioning meetings to update the wider project group.
* Supporting or attending FATs, factory witness testing, and system demonstrations when required.
* Checking that site commissioning activities follow the approved procedures and safety standards.
* Coordinating closely with the QA/QC function and Authorised Persons to maintain consistency across the project.
* Helping to manage the tagging, documentation and sign-off process for systems as they progress through commissioning stages.
